Full Description
This book combines extended period cover with detailed study of sources on key issues and topics
'Document Exercises', offer opportunities for assessment and exam practice. Covering almost 150 years between unification and reunification, with a particular emphasis on the interwar years.
This book encourages students to think for themselves around the issues that have affected German history and to consider important historical debates and controversies.
